    Default Rise and Shine

    My youngest daughter gifted my hubby and I with the news that we were to be grandparents. So off to my pattern and fabric stash I went. I finally settled on an old Quiltmaker pattern from 2007. I used the colors suggested (especially since she was having a boy) blues, purples, yellows, golds and neutrals. Since my daughter loves Dr. Seuss, I used a panel and Dr. Seuss fabric for the backing.

    My grandson was born this past August and hubby and I went to meet him early this month. I got to spend two weeks cuddling and spoiling my new grandson Lincoln, and visiting with my sweet daughter and son-in-law.

    Here is Lincoln's quilt.
